What are we going into debt for? $21 million for a “Greener” 80-year-old...

The city of Duluth wants to convert its 1930's coal-fired steam plant to a hot-water system fueled by wood. It needs $21 million from state taxpayers for the project. We take a closer look at the borrowing request.

What are we going into debt for? $8 million St. Paul bridge fix...

Less than 18 months ago, St. Paul city planners estimated the cost to fix the Kellogg Boulevard-Third St. Bridge at $8 million with an $40 million estimate to replace the entire bridge. Today the city's requesting that Minnesota taxpayers borrow $52 million for the project which will add dedicated bus lanes, bike lanes, and room for future light rail.
